Situation
Dispatch messages arrive via SMS or pager and have to be interpreted on the spot — where exactly is the incident, what level? Precious time is lost in the critical first minutes, while proprietary alarm displays are expensive and existing screens in the station sit idle.
Objective
One solution, one screen: an information board with announcements, images, tickers and weather in normal operation — and within seconds a full-screen alarm view with the incident on a map, alarm level and an acoustic signal when it counts. On standard hardware, no special devices.
Execution
The dispatch centre’s alarm SMS is processed automatically — location, level and map view are extracted and pushed to all connected screens in real time. Administration is fully self-service: invite members, trigger test alarms, manage vehicles; crews confirm via smartphone app, and an optional impulse opens the station door.
